Interestingly, Capcom revealed that Onimusha: Warlords was initially to be a spin-off from the Resident Evil series, only with ninjas. Seeing as how the original Onimusha: Warlords wasn't really a walk in the park, the dev implemented Easy mode, which is now accessible from the start.
